Title: Innovations of Chih-Hsin Shih: A Pioneer in Microfluidics
Introduction
Chih-Hsin Shih is a notable inventor based in Taichung, Taiwan. He has made significant contributions to the field of microfluidics, holding a total of three patents. His work focuses on enhancing biochemical testing methodologies, which has implications for various medical applications.
Latest Patents
One of Chih-Hsin Shih's latest patents is a microfluidics-based analyzer and method for fluid control. This invention includes a drive module and a microfluidic disc, where a capillary connects a mixing chamber to a waste chamber. The design allows for operation at different rotational speeds, improving the efficiency of washing processes. Another significant patent is an apparatus and methodology for biochemical testing on a centrifugal platform using a flow-splitting technique. This innovation simplifies the loading of reagents, allowing for efficient distribution across multiple reaction chambers, thereby reducing manpower and costs associated with conventional testing methods.
